⭐ Featured Review

Loss and mercy
by pauleskridge2025-02-06
7/10

"Seven stars. Watching Griffith's Civil War shorts, one might get the idea that everyone fighting in the War did so just down the block from their family home. A great narrative convenience, that! But to the point. This film rehashes a lot of the themes from "In the Border States," but does so in a less compelling way. Here it's the mother of a (Confederate) soldier who hides a (Union) soldier from the pursuit of the other side. Despite some very strong reasons for her not to. None of the acting is worth much note here. Kate Bruce and Dorothy West both did much better work ..."
